The Robotics in Shipbuilding Market growth has become a transformative factor in reshaping the global shipbuilding industry. Shipbuilding, traditionally dependent on extensive human labor, has increasingly shifted toward automation to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and productivity. Robotics in this sector is not just a matter of technological adoption but a necessity to meet global demand and reduce costs while improving quality.
The Global Robotics In Shipbuilding Market is projected to grow from 6.73 USD Billion in 2024 to 40.9 USD Billion by 2035, reflecting a robust growth trajectory. This expansion is a clear signal of how crucial robotics has become for modern shipbuilding practices. With automation, processes like welding, material handling, assembly, and inspection are being executed faster, safer, and with greater precision.
The demand for advanced vessels—from cargo ships and oil tankers to naval fleets—is also fueling this adoption. Robotics enables builders to handle larger workloads efficiently, ensuring timely delivery without compromising safety or performance. Robotics also helps reduce workplace accidents, as many shipbuilding tasks involve high-risk environments.
Countries such as South Korea, China, and Japan dominate the global shipbuilding industry, and their heavy investment in robotics underscores the competitive edge automation provides. Europe and North America are also adopting robotics at scale, driven by modernization efforts and growing maritime trade.
In the coming years, robotics integration in shipbuilding will likely accelerate with advancements in artificial intelligence, IoT-enabled monitoring, and predictive maintenance tools. These developments will streamline operations while enhancing long-term vessel performance.
